The Booking Flow: Where It Gets Interesting
The heart of any booking platform is, well, the booking flow. Here's where things get technically interesting.
Real-Time Availability Without the Headache
One of the trickiest parts was managing cabin availability in real-time. When a user selects dates, we need to:
1. Query all existing bookings for that cabin
2. Check for date conflicts
3. Calculate pricing based on the date range
4. Apply any seasonal discounts or special offers
5. Display this instantly to the user
We handle this with a combination of MongoDB's powerful aggregation pipeline and React Query's intelligent caching. When you select dates in the calendar, React Query fetches availability data and caches it. If you come back to that same cabin later in your session, the data is already there—no unnecessary network requests.
The Confirmation Page: A Small Detail That Makes All the Difference
Initially, successful bookings just showed a toast notification. You'd see "Booking confirmed!" for a few seconds, and then... nothing. Users had to rely on email to verify what they'd just booked.
I completely redesigned this into a dedicated confirmation page. Now when you submit a booking, you're redirected to a unique URL with:
- Complete booking details with a shareable link
- An itemized price breakdown
- Status tracking
- Authorization checks to ensure you can only see your own bookings
This wasn't just better UX—it solved a real security concern. With proper authorization checks, users can only access confirmation pages for their own bookings, not someone else's by simply guessing URLs.

The Data Layer: MongoDB Models That Make Sense
Here's something I learned: your data models should reflect your business logic, not the other way around.
Take the `Booking` model. It doesn't just store a cabin ID and dates. It includes:
- Embedded extras and services (early check-in, airport transfers, etc.)
- Special requests from guests
- Status tracking (pending, confirmed, cancelled)
- Price calculations with deposits
- Customer references tied to Clerk authentication
This means when you fetch a booking, you get everything you need in one query. No waterfall of subsequent requests to piece together the full picture.
Performance Optimizations I'm Proud Of
Image Optimization: Every cabin image passes through Next.js's Image component, which automatically:
- Generates multiple sizes for different screen resolutions
- Serves modern formats (WebP, AVIF) when supported
- Lazy loads images below the fold
- Provides blur placeholders for a premium feel
Code Splitting: The booking form is quite complex with date pickers, guest counters, and extras selection. Using dynamic imports, we only load this code when users actually visit a cabin detail page. The home page stays lean and fast.
Smart Caching: With TanStack Query, we cache cabin listings with a 5-minute stale time. This means if you browse through cabins and come back to one, it renders instantly from cache while being revalidated in the background.

What I'd Do Differently
No project is perfect. Here are some lessons learned:
1. Start with E2E tests earlier: I added Playwright tests late in the project. Starting with E2E testing from day one would have caught some edge cases sooner.
2. Implement feature flags: When rolling out the new confirmation page, I had to deploy it all at once. Feature flags would have let me test with a small percentage of users first.
3. More aggressive caching: MongoDB queries could be cached more aggressively with Redis for frequently accessed data like cabin listings.
